With a dream conceived by Edsel Ford and a prototype designed by Bob Gregorie, this Full Classic Lincoln reflected a thoroughly European “continental” style with the inclusion of an externally mounted spare tire. Since only 454 Continentals were produced in 1941, this automobile is considered one of the icons of its 
era — still known for its timeless design, luxurious, innovative features and modern, classic lines. 
Focusing on a well-proportioned yet spare design, the brightwork was largely restricted to the grille. Push-button door releases were a new feature for 1941, as were fully operational, electrically powered top and self-canceling turn signals. 
This lovely Lincoln runs smoothly and has had a major tune-up less than 300 miles ago. It features a 292 cubic inch L-head V12 with a factory-installed Borg-Warner overdrive. The transmission is a 3-speed manual with front and rear transverse leaf springs and four-wheel hydraulic drum brakes. 
The interior is a rare combination of tan Bedford whipcord and green leather. In fact, only
four 1941 Continentals were built with this distinctive look. The interior was replaced except for the back seat, door panels and both arm rests, all of which are original. These were left this way to show how nice they were originally. They are in such good condition it is difficult to tell the new front seat from the original back seat. The dash is original with all working gauges and instruments, including the radio. 
The trunk carpet is new old stock to original specs. This is one of only 35 Cabriolets painted Spade Green that year, and the exterior is still very presentable with no dents or scratches. The chrome is all original and sparkles like new. And, to give you an even smoother ride, a new set of Coker radials have been installed.
This beauty spent its early years on Long Island and has had only two owners in the last 32 years. Jarvis Barton, a Lincoln aficionado and restorer, owned it for 25 years. He rebuilt the engine and added an electric fuel pump. This car has never been apart, is mostly original and presents as if were a fresh restoration.
It is currently enjoying life in Connecticut and loves Sunday Cars and Coffee outings. This car should easily take a top award at any Grand Classic and successfully complete a CCCA Caravan.
